This plugin lets you easily edit the footer credit text for Storefront theme from customizer. No need for any code.

The original copyright text will be replaced by one or two widgetitzed areas, then you can put on it any widget: image, text, menu, etc.

This plugin will work only on Storefront theme WooCommerce theme.

Features:

  • Replace the Storefront copyright text by one (fullwidth) or two (two columns) sidebars (widgetitzed areas)
  • Place on the new footer sidebar(s) everything what you want, through widgets: logo, menus, text, html, etc.
  • Choose text align on every area: centered, left, right
  • Manage widgets nicely through customizer in the wordpress way, as any other sidebar
  • Format the menus in copyright in one line, or keep it in the standard sidebar menu look and feel.
  • You still can use the upper footer sidebars that come with Storefront, this plugin REPLACE the copyright with new one(s).

How to use:

  1. Navigate to Customizer page under Appearance.
  2. Find the Footer Section.
  3. Under the Footer section, scroll down and you will find the alignment and menu style preferences.
  4. Switch to the Widgets Section.
  5. You will find a two new ones: Copyright Content Left and Copyright Content Right
  6. Place on it the content as you need, by adding widgets
  7. Leave the right content empty to make the left fullwidth (you will see the difference if you choose centered align)
